Research and Development of High Performance YHFT Digital Signal Processor

  • YHFT-DSP/700 is a high performance floating-point VLIW DSP developed in 2004. Its frequency is 238MHz and its peak performance is 1,428MFLOPS and 1,904MIPS. The architecture, design methodology and compiler techniques of YHFT-DSP/700 are presented. The latest simultaneous multi-threading DSP architecture called YHFT-DSP/SMT is proposed, which improves the system throughput by 40%. The architecture and development trends of the mainstream high performance DSPs are analyzed as well.
